一种播放/决策方法/系统、介质、播放端及服务端技术方案

技术编号:22081912 阅读:36 留言:0更新日期:2019-09-12 16:21
本发明专利技术提供一种播放/决策方法/系统、介质、播放端及服务端,所述播放方法包括:获取一播放指令,并由此生成播放请求发送于服务端;根据服务端的所述最优播放策略进行多媒体数据播放。所述决策方法包括:接收播放请求;确定基于历史的播放策略,同时分析所述播放请求中所含有属性信息在预定时间段内的播放行为,以确定基于预定时间段的播放策略,以此形成最优播放策略;将所述最优播放策略发送至播放端。本发明专利技术可使播放端有效的抵抗互联网网络的波动,从整体上提供端到端最优的流媒体体验。

A Player/Decision Method/System, Media, Player and Server

【技术实现步骤摘要】
一种播放/决策方法/系统、介质、播放端及服务端
本专利技术属于智能播放
,涉及一种基于智能分析的播放决策方法,特别是涉及一种播放/决策方法/系统、介质、播放端及服务端。
技术介绍
目前,针对播放端在播放时出现的卡顿和不流畅问题,现有技术的思路是针对可能的情况尽可能的减少因为网络传输问题影响的用户感官上的感受。并由此提出以下方法:一方面从视频编码层解决问题,将流媒体数据分成高优先级(也常称为基本层)和低优先级(也常称为增强层),基本层提供解码所需的基本信息,从这些信息中解码可得到次一级的图像和声音质量,如果再能得到增强层的数据,就可以得到完整质量的图像和声音。基本层数据是独立于增强层数据解码的,但增强层必须依赖于基本层才能解码。通过将数据分成基本层和增强层,就可以在网络发生拥塞的时候,只传送基本层的数据。由于基本层的数据一般只占全部流媒体数据的一小部分,这样就可以大大缓解网络的拥塞程度;另一方面从视频编码层和网络协议层解决问题,目前互联网上普遍使用的流媒体HLS协议,就是从视频编码层和网络协议层解决这一问题,在视频编码时候,将一个视频节目,同时编码成码率不同的几个输出流。将每一个本文档来自技高网...

【技术保护点】
1.一种播放方法,其特征在于,应用于播放端及与所述播放端通信连接的服务端的播放网络;所述播放方法包括:获取一播放指令,并根据所述播放指令生成播放请求发送于服务端;待接收到所述服务端反馈的与所述播放请求对应的最优播放策略后,根据所述最优播放策略进行多媒体数据播放。

【技术特征摘要】
1.一种播放方法,其特征在于,应用于播放端及与所述播放端通信连接的服务端的播放网络;所述播放方法包括:获取一播放指令,并根据所述播放指令生成播放请求发送于服务端;待接收到所述服务端反馈的与所述播放请求对应的最优播放策略后,根据所述最优播放策略进行多媒体数据播放。2.根据权利要求1所述的播放方法,其特征在于,在所述待接收到所述服务端反馈的与所述播放请求对应的最优播放策略后,根据所述最优播放策略进行多媒体数据播放的步骤之后,所述播放方法还包括:在多媒体数据播放过程中,采集播放行为数据,并将所述播放行为数据反馈于服务端;所述播放行为数据用于分析该用户的接入网质量,包括:初始缓冲时间、上报时刻、用户的码率、每个切片获取的开始时间和结束时间、缓冲区剩余切片的填充状况、卡顿发生的开始时间和结束时间、用户的暂停操作、用户的拖拽操作和/或用户的退出操作。3.根据权利要求1所述的播放方法,其特征在于,所述播放指令包括:流媒体播放地址、终端设备串号、设备类型、设备地理位置、用户鉴权信息和/或安全令牌信息;所述播放请求包括:要播放的节目编号、用户的IP地址、设备类型、设备串号和/或设备地理位置。4.根据权利要求1所述的播放方法,其特征在于,在按照所述最优播放策略进行内容播放时,通过所述最优播放策略中所建议使用的基础内容分发网络获取视频切片,且开始播放之后持续获取视频切片的内容进行播放。5.一种决策方法,其特征在于,应用于播放端及与所述播放端通信连接的服务端的播放网络;所述决策方法包括:接收源于播放端的播放请求;分析所述播放请求中所含有属性信息的历史播放行为,以确定基于历史的播放策略,同时分析所述播放请求中所含有属性信息在预定时间段内的播放行为,以确定基于预定时间段的播放策略;将所述基于历史的播放策略和所述基于预定时间段的播放策略依据预设的调用策略相融合,以形成最优播放策略;所述预设的调用策略用于对所述基于历史的播放策略和所述基于预定时间段的播放策略做加权处理后确定最优播放建议;将所述最优播放策略发送至播放端以使其执行所述最优播放策略。6.根据权利要求5所述的决策方法,其特征在于,在所述将所述最优播放策略发送至播放端以使其执行所述最优播放策略的步骤之后,所述决策方法还包括:在所述播放端执行所述最优播放策略的过程中统计其播放策略数据,以更新用于分析的历史播放行为和预定时间段的播放行为。7.根据权利要求5所述的决策方法,其特征在于,所述分析所述播放请求中所含有属性信息的历史播放行为以确定基于历史的播放策略,并分析所述播放请求中所含有属性信息在预定时间段的播放行为以确定基于预定时间段的播放策略的步骤包括:通过一数据分析引擎分析该用户的IP地址、该设备类型、该设备串号、该地理位置、该接入网在历史上的播放行为,以确定所述数据分析引擎给出历史上的播放策略;通过一实时分析引擎分析该用户的IP地址、该设备类型、该设备串号、该地理位置、该接入网在预定时间段的播放行为,以确定所述实时分析引擎给出的播放策略。8.根据权利要求5或7所述的决策方法,其特征在于,所述播放行为包括:播放时选择的基础内容分发网络厂家、选择的该基础内容分发网络厂家的边缘内容分发网络服务器、该用户的接入网质量和/或该用户历史的播放流畅度;所述最优播放策略包括:建议使用的基础内容分发网络、建议使用的边缘内容分发网络服务器、建议使用的运营商线路、建议使用的起播码率、播放端起播时建议使用的预取缓存数量和/或建议何时开始播放。9.根据权利要求7所述的决策方法,其特征在于,所述将所述基于历史的播放策略和所述基于预定时间段的播...

【专利技术属性】
技术研发人员:肖友能黄思钧张晓卫张超侯卫华
申请(专利权)人:亦非云互联网技术上海有限公司
类型:发明
国别省市:上海,31

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1